LEPKE RICHARD A

CW2 Richard "Dickasaurus Rex" A Lepke was a potential VHPA member who died after his tour in Vietnam on 01/22/2013 at the age of 69.7
Mitchell, SD
Flight Classes 67-15 and 67-13
Date of Birth 05/16/1943
Served in the U.S. Army
Served in Vietnam with 174 AHC in 68

More detail on this person: Richard "Dick" Lepke Richard "Dick" Lepke, age 69, of Mitchell, SD died Tuesday, January 22, 2013 at Doughtery Hospice House in Sioux Falls, SD. Richard "Dick" Allen Lepke was born May 16, 1943, in Mitchell, S.D. to Ted and Evelyn (Anderson) Lepke. Dick graduated from Mitchell Public Schools in 1962. He briefly attended college and then joined the Army and was trained as a helicopter pilot in 1964. He completed a tour in Vietnam and later returned to Ft. Rucker, Alabama in 1968, where he was assigned as an instructor pilot Army Aviators. On October 26, 1968, he married Donna Jean VanLaecken at Zion Lutheran Church in Mitchell. They began their lives together in Alabama for the next two years as they continued his active service in the Army. Upon his Honorable Discharge from Active Duty, Dick continued his long military service when he joined the South Dakota Army National Guard in Mitchell, while at the same time he tried his hand at farming in the local area with his uncle Walt. After two years of farming, Dick was hired to serve full-time with the National Guard as a Technician, first in Huron, for a period of four years, and the remainder of his time with the Army National Guard was served as a Technician in Mitchell. Dick retired from military service in May 2003 as a Chief Warrant Officer with 38 years of faithful service to his country. During his life Dick enjoyed traveling throughout the country with the South Dakota National Guard State Rifle and Pistol Team. Additionally, he was an avid hunter, golfer, fisherman, and card player. Later in life, he also loved to travel with Donna, visiting family and many popular vacation destinations.
